Andhra Pradesh launches urgent drive to restore Kolleru Lake

State will submit land boundary proposals on Kolleru Lake sanctuary to the Central Empowered Committee and Supreme Court for review.

Overview

  • Chief Minister N. Chandrababu Naidu ordered the removal of encroachments on the Upputeru channel to ensure unimpeded lake discharge into the sea.
  • He directed desilting of drains feeding Kolleru Lake and treatment of inflows to halt unchecked pollution.
  • The government will revive the 2018 wildlife board recommendation by submitting proposals to exclude 20,000 acres of Jirayat and D-Patta lands from the sanctuary.
  • Around three lakh residents in the lake’s contour region will benefit from measures that aim to balance ecological protection with local livelihoods.
  • A statewide tree-planting campaign on June 5 will target one crore saplings to support a green cover increase from 30.5% toward a 37% goal by 2033.
